DFS NFL Week 9 DraftKings Milly Maker Review

The Milly Maker is a large Field GPP where the top prize pays out $1,000,000. Read the winning trends that we’ve found by reviewing years of winning lineups!

Surprisingly, in a week full of backup Quarterbacks and weak Vegas lines, we got a thick game stack and a 250-point winning Milly Maker score. The winning lineup was built by one of the DFS Players that many believe is the Greatest of All Time – YouDacao. Youdacao certainly proved that this kind of build – although it will lose you money most slates – can leverage the field like no other when it finally hits. You can’t play scared in Large Field GPP’s and that’s exactly how one of the best was able to take the $1,000,0000 home.

Stacking

At DFS Army, we were on Stroud stacks this week with Dell and Collins as the primary stacking partners, as well as Noah Brown and Schultz as contarian pivots. However, Stroud + 3 Pass Catchers is what you needed and even the Stroud + Dell + Schultz Tournament stack that I had wasn’t enough for a takedown because you needed Noah Brown’s 30-point performance at only $3,100 salary.

C.J. Stroud 44.8 FPTS + Tank Dell 32.6 FPTS + Noah Brown 30.3 FPTS + Dalton Schultz 31 FPTS + Rachaad White 27.9 FPTS.

Total Stacking Points:  166.6 FPTS

Total Stacking Ownership: 33.20%

This lineup really differentiated itself from the field with the Houston/Tampa stack that had 2 players at 5% ownership or less and Stroud + Dell at under 10% ownership. Despite having 34% Lamb and 17% Jacobs, this lineup was contrarian due to the Tampa/Houston game stack and specifically the targeted players of Brown and Schultz that kept it contarian.

Top Leverage Plays

C.J.  Stroud at 6%

This is obvious. He was the highest scoring QB on the slate by a large margin and was under 10% ownership and only $6200.

Tank Dell at 6%

Tank Dell was the highest scoring WR on the slate. He was leverage off of everybody but specifically guys like AJ Brown, Nico Collins, and Amari Cooper.

Noah Brown at 3%

Top 3 in scoring at $3100 and under 4% ownership.

Dalton Schultz at 5%

Schultz was far and away the top TE leverage play as he outscored second place by 7 points and was under 5% ownership.

The key ingredient to this entire lineup – from a multitude of angles – was the stack. The Houston/Tampa team stack was the perfect mix of scoring, ownership leverage, and pricing. Stroud hit 7.22X, Dell hit 6.15X, Brown hit 9.77X, Schultz 7.38X, and White hit 4.98X as the bring back. This stack carried the rest of the lineup which is why Bijan’s dud of 1.13X didn’t even matter. The entire lineup hit 5.02X and didn’t use all $50,000 of salary – something that has happened 7 out of 9 times this year. Also, again there wasn’t a player above $8500. 7 out of 9 weeks this year we haven’t had a player above $8500 in the winning Milly Maker Lineup.

Ceiling

The takeaway for me in this lineup is that even when the Vegas lines point to a low scoring week, all it takes is for one game to go off, and just that one lineup to nail it perfectly, for the ceiling to be much higher than we had projected. This lineup was the 4th time this season when a winning Milly Maker lineup hit 250 point sor more.
